Understanding DeFi Rebates
DeFi rebates are rewards offered by platforms to incentivize users to engage with their services. These rebates can come in various forms, including tokens, interest, or cashback. They're often used to promote liquidity, increase user engagement, and foster a thriving ecosystem. For part-time investors, these rebates present an opportunity to earn passive income without committing full-time resources.
The Mechanics of DeFi Rebates
DeFi rebate systems typically work through smart contracts, which automate the distribution of rewards. These contracts are self-executing, ensuring transparency and reducing the need for intermediaries. Platforms often use rebate strategies to enhance liquidity, encourage staking, or to promote new features.
To maximize your rebate earnings, it's crucial to understand the underlying mechanics. Here's a simplified breakdown:
Liquidity Pools: Many DeFi platforms offer liquidity pools where users can deposit pairs of tokens and earn a share of the trading fees. Rebates can be a part of this reward structure, offering additional incentives for providing liquidity.
Staking Rewards: Some platforms distribute a portion of their staking rewards as rebates to encourage more users to stake their tokens. This helps in maintaining network security and liquidity.
Yield Farming: Yield farming involves moving your assets between various DeFi platforms to earn the highest possible returns. Platforms often offer rebates to users who farm yields across their ecosystems.

Leveraging Advanced Yield Farming Techniques
Yield farming remains one of the most effective ways to earn passive income in DeFi. However, to truly maximize your rebates, you need to employ advanced techniques that go beyond simple liquidity provision. Here are some strategies to consider:
Multi-Hop Yield Farming: Instead of investing in a single platform, multi-hop yield farming involves moving your assets between multiple platforms to capture the highest possible returns. This strategy requires careful planning and execution but can lead to significant rebate earnings.
Impermanent Loss Management: Impermanent loss occurs when the price of tokens in a liquidity pool changes, potentially reducing your overall returns. To mitigate this, you can periodically rebalance your liquidity pool or use options and derivatives to hedge against impermanent loss.
Stablecoin Swapping: Stablecoins like USDT and USDC are popular in DeFi due to their stability. Swapping between different stablecoins on various platforms can yield small but consistent rebate earnings. Just ensure you understand the fee structures and liquidity of each platform.
Compounding Rebates: Some DeFi platforms offer compounding interest on your staked or liquidity-provided tokens. By reinvesting your rebates, you can accelerate your earnings over time. Platforms like Compound and Aave offer this feature, allowing you to continuously earn on your earnings.
